Abstract

The contribution is focused on design and realization of planar capacitive proximity sensor based on DuPont GreenTape™ 951 LTCC. Based on Comsol Multiphysics simulation software results, planar capacitive proximity sensors with different structures and topologies were realized and measured. After accelerated ageing test series, capacitive sensors stability parameters were measured. Developed capacitive proximity sensors had been characterized. Influence of different sensor topologies and structures on capacitive sensor's performance was analyzed.
